**RESPONSIBILITIES**
- Responsible for assistance, tactical execution, tracking and day-to-day administration of the South Central Ontario regions’ marketing and business development strategy and initiatives
- Support the region in all areas of marketing, including events, sponsorships, advertising, direct marketing, publicity, digital marketing, website, and social media
- Administrative - managing the marketing calendar, scheduling meetings with agendas, keeping minutes, room bookings, mailing and courier items, formatting marketing documents
- Marketing Requests - updating marketing documents, submitting practitioner bios, event invites and general firm ads, printing corporate material, and coordinating photoshoots for practitioner headshots
- Event Management - sourcing vendor quotes, liaising with vendors, registration deployment and tracking, consolidating attendee lists, day of support and logistics support both virtually and in person
- Budgeting - updating financial tracking documents, providing the team with regular updates, consolidating monthly spends, submitting, organizing and tracking invoices
- Internal Communications - compiling, editing and distributing marketing updates and success stories
- Resource and Asset Management - maintaining, refreshing and tracking stock of collateral and promo items, updating client and contact lists, maintaining a library of general firm ads and tracking of tradeshow materials
- Vendors - seeking new vendors, maintaining preferred vendor list, scheduling of virtual demonstrations or site visits and relationship building with vendors
- Produce and format documents such as presentations, correspondence and standard reports
- Perform administrative duties specific to the marketing department such as updating and maintaining databases, client lists and preparing materials for distribution to clients
- Support the marketing team with the implementation of the various Marketing Plan tactics (event development presentations, signage, brochures, etc.)
- Help with the coordination of event marketing and marketing campaigns
- Assist with the coordination of client prospect programs in conjunction with other internal resources, and other internal marketing related initiatives
- Conduct other projects and ad-hoc activities/events
- Gather and compile market research for planning purposes
- Maintain marketing materials promotional items, brochures and tradeshow equipment
- Provide incremental administrative support to the regional management team as needed

**S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E**
- Completion of a post-secondary degree or diploma in marketing, communications, project management, English, journalism, or related discipline
- Minimum of one (1) year of experience in a marketing capacity and a demonstrated understanding of the marketing process and project coordination
- Strong administrative skills are essential, including organizational skills, attention to detail and prioritization
- Strong computer literacy, including effective working skills of Microsoft Word, Excel and PowerPoint
- Self motivating with the ability to work in a fast-paced environment with mínimal supervision
- Strong interpersonal skills are required as this role is part of a highly collaborative team where the expectation is that everyone participates in the team’s success, regardless of seniority
- Maintain flexibility to travel, as necessary. While based in Burlington, our South Central Ontario region includes offices in St. Catharines, Burlington, Waterloo and Cambridge, as well as on-site event support, so some travel will be required (approx. 10-20%)
